Nviron Hive & Npontu partner to boost Africa’s ESG & Climate Tech

In celebration of Earth Day 2025, Nviron Hive Limited and Npontu Technologies have announced a strategic partnership aimed at driving progress in the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G), climate, and technology sectors across the African continent.

This collaboration unites Nviron Hive’s proficiency in sustainability advisory services and green financing solutions with Npontu’s technological strengths in Artificial Intelligence and Big Data, Software and Mobile App development, Value-Added-Services, and IT Consulting and Managed Services.

The partnership’s initial undertaking will be the development of the flagship Nviron Tech platform.

“Our partnership embodies the spirit of this year’s Earth Day theme, ‘Our Power, Our Planet,'” stated Otema Yirenkyi, Co-Founder of Nviron Hive Limited. “By combining our respective strengths in sustainability and technology, we’re creating solutions that harness our collective power to protect our shared planet while driving economic growth.”

At the core of this collaboration lies the innovative Nviron Tech platform—envisioned as Ghana’s leading green investment and crowdfunding marketplace. This comprehensive platform will be rolled out in phases:

Phase 1:

  • Investment: A crowdfunding component designed to connect sustainable projects with investors.
  • Insights: An insights and education platform offering market intelligence and capacity building resources.

Phase 2:

  • Enhancements to investment capabilities, including deal rooms and additional investment instruments.
  • A community-building system to foster collaboration and provide a convening space for stakeholders within the green economy.

“Africa stands at a critical crossroads in its development journey,” commented Stephane Nwolley, CEO of Npontu Technologies. “Through our AI-powered platform, we’re creating the digital infrastructure needed to ensure that growth across the continent is both economically viable and environmentally sustainable. This isn’t just about technology—it’s about creating a framework for a thriving, renewable future.”

The Nviron Tech platform will leverage advanced AI to deliver three key innovations:

  • Intelligent investor matching algorithms that connect green projects with suitable funding sources.
  • AI-driven market intelligence and data visualization tools that track sustainability trends.
  • Automated impact metrics to quantify the environmental benefits of investments.

The platform will support a variety of investment structures, including equity-based investments, debt-based lending, revenue-sharing arrangements, and convertible notes, thereby broadening access to sustainable investing for a wider range of participants.

“We’re beginning our sustainability journey by focusing on investing in projects within renewable energy, sustainable agriculture and e-mobility,” added Dzifa Amageshie, Co-Founder at Nviron Hive Limited. “To mark Earth Day, we are leading the way with action. Before asking others live and work more sustainably, we’re transforming the Npontu Technologies offices with native plant landscaping. We’ll then expand this green initiative to surrounding neighbourhoods, embodying our belief in being the change we want to see.” Deborah Asamah, Business Development Executive, further emphasized this commitment.

This partnership arrives at a crucial time as the world focuses on tripling renewable energy capacity by 2030—a central objective of Earth Day 2025’s “Our Power, Our Planet” campaign. The Nviron Hive-Npontu partnership directly addresses this by integrating renewable energy solutions across all their projects and providing specialized financial mechanisms to fund clean energy transitions that align with government and development priorities, noted Kwame Agyepong, Co-Founder of Nviron Hive Limited.

“Our ambition extends beyond building a platform—we’re creating an ecosystem that will accelerate Africa’s transition to renewable energy and sustainable development,” said Otema Yirenkyi, Co-Founder of Nviron Hive Limited. “The technology we’re developing will make it easier for everyone to participate in this vital transition.”

About Nviron Hive Limited:

Nviron Hive is a sustainability-focused enterprise specializing in advisory services, green financing solutions, and strategic value creation within the renewable energy sector and nature-based solutions. The company is dedicated to developing impactful approaches that address climate change by leveraging sustainable financial expertise and ecological innovations.

About Npontu Technologies:

Npontu Technologies is a leading technology company specializing in Big Data and Artificial Intelligence, Software and Mobile App development, Value-Added-Services, and IT Consulting & Managed Services for businesses.
